per principianti/facilità d'uso:
* browser db per sqlite (db4s): GRATUITO, Open-Source e incredibilmente intuitivo. Eccellente per l'apprendimento di SQL e la gestione di database più piccoli. SQLite è un database incorporato leggero, perfetto per applicazioni o apprendimento semplici. Tuttavia, non è adatto per applicazioni su larga scala o ad alte prestazioni.
per professionisti/applicazioni più grandi:
* Mysql Workbench: GRATUITO e potente, offrendo una GUI robusta per la gestione dei database MySQL. MySQL è un sistema di gestione di database relazionali ampiamente utilizzato (RDBMS) adatto a molte applicazioni, da piccole a molto grandi. Richiede una conoscenza un po 'più tecnica rispetto a DB4.
* Posgresql.App: Un comodo pacchetto MAC per PostgreSQL, un potente, open-source e RDBMS altamente scalabile. Offre prestazioni eccellenti e funzionalità avanzate. Come MySQL, è più adatto agli utenti con qualche esperienza di database.
* Datagrip (jetbrains): Un IDE commerciale, multipiattaforma specificamente progettato per lo sviluppo del database. Supporta una vasta gamma di sistemi di database (MySQL, PostgreSQL, SQLite, Oracle, SQL Server, ecc.) E offre funzionalità avanzate come il completamento del codice, il debug e il refactoring. È una scelta forte se hai bisogno di un ambiente di sviluppo sofisticato.
Altre considerazioni:
* sviluppatore SQL (Oracle): Libero da Oracle, ma progettato principalmente per i database Oracle. Buono se stai lavorando con Oracle Systems.
* Sequel Pro: (Deprecate - non più mantenuto) Sebbene una volta popolare, Sequel Pro non viene più aggiornato e dovrebbe essere evitato.
Strategia di raccomandazione:
1. Valuta le tue esigenze: Quanto è grande il tuo database? Che tipo di applicazioni supporterà? Qual è il tuo budget? Qual è il tuo livello di esperienza SQL?
2. Inizia semplice (se possibile): Se stai imparando o hai un piccolo progetto, il browser DB per SQLite è un ottimo punto di partenza.
3. Considera la scalabilità: Per applicazioni più grandi o più complesse, MySQL Workbench o Postgresql.App sono contendenti forti.
4. Investi in uno strumento professionale (se necessario): Se sei uno sviluppatore serio o hai bisogno di funzionalità avanzate, DataGrip è una scelta migliore ma ha un prezzo.
In sintesi, non esiste un singolo "migliore", ma le opzioni sopra soddisfano varie esigenze e livelli di abilità. Considera attentamente le tue esigenze prima di prendere una decisione. Molti di questi offrono prove gratuite o edizioni della comunità, permettendoti di testarli prima di impegnarti.
software © www.354353.com